Kakao prepares a forum for discussion of controversial personnel evaluation system

Input 2021.02.24 13:53




In March, Kakao decided to set up a meeting to directly explain to employees about the controversial personnel evaluation system. Initially, the content was expected to be discussed at an in-house meeting on donation by Chairman Kim Bum-soo, but there was a need to share opinions more closely, so a separate time was prepared.

According to related industries on the 24th, Kakao decided to hold’Open Talk’ on March 11th and discuss the personnel evaluation system and compensation system. Employees can present their opinions here. Management takes part, centering on the Kakao HR team. There is also a possibility that Yeo Min-su and Jo Soo-yong, joint representatives of Kakao, will attend.

The contents were expected to be discussed at’Brian Talk After’, an in-house meeting related to the donation of property by Chairman Kim Bum-soo, which was held on the 25th. However, Kakao decided to set up a separate seat. Although it is possible to present opinions at the conference, we decided that it would be difficult to deal with the issue of Kakao personnel evaluation in a place where all Kakao affiliates’ employees were present, so we set aside a place.

An official from Kakao said, “Open Talk is a place where all employees can freely share their opinions, and we will be able to improve the personnel evaluation system by reflecting the opinions presented on this day.” .

Recently, a problem was raised about Kakao’s personnel evaluation system in the blind app, an anonymous community of office workers. In Kakao’s peer-review system at the end of the year, there is an item that says’I don’t want to work together’, but it was pointed out that this should be improved. It is criticized that the method of sharing the response results with the parties is harsh.
